目录
一、 材料准备
二、 设备连接
2.1、插入模块、串口线
2.2、连接ST-Link仿真器
三、腾讯云物联网平台创建
3.1、账号注册、登入
3.2、创建项目
3.3、创建、配置产品
四、代码修改、程序下载、配置
4.1、计算Name、Password
4.2、修改代码
4.3、配置ST-Link仿真器
4.4、代码下载
五、查看数据
5.1、查看上传的温湿度数据

一、材料准备

准备以下材料

esp8266可以接ttl的数据么_云计算


二、设备连接

2.1、插入模块、串口线

将ESP8266模块按照图中所示插入指定位置

esp8266可以接ttl的数据么_云计算_02


将串口线一端插入到STM32L的USB口,另一端插入到电脑的USB口

esp8266可以接ttl的数据么_仿真器_03


2.2、连接ST-Link仿真器

用3条杜邦线接入STM32L的 DIO、GND、CLK中

esp8266可以接ttl的数据么_云计算_04

另一头的杜邦线接入仿真器,仿真器USB接口接入电脑。(注:仔细看自己仿真器的引脚顺序SWDIO、GND、SWCLK的位置,有些仿真器的引脚顺序和我使用的不一样。

esp8266可以接ttl的数据么_esp8266可以接ttl的数据么_05


esp8266可以接ttl的数据么_stm32_06


三、腾讯云物联网平台创建

3.1、账号注册、登入

腾讯云:

https://cloud.tencent.com/ 进入腾讯云物联网平台登录页面。


若已有账号,则直接登录。若没有账号,则按照官方提示进行注册。

注册完成之后进行登录

按照提示搜索物联网平台点击进入


点击实例进入


3.2、创建项目

按照提示创建项目



项目创建完成


3.3、创建、配置产品

按照提示创建产品




产品创建完成


按照提示配置产品信息


新建温湿度功能


新建温度功能


新建湿度功能


功能新建完成,点击下一步


按提示进行操作

esp8266可以接ttl的数据么_云计算_07按提示进行操作

esp8266可以接ttl的数据么_云计算_08


按提示进行设备的创建

esp8266可以接ttl的数据么_esp8266可以接ttl的数据么_09


esp8266可以接ttl的数据么_stm32_10


设备创建完成

esp8266可以接ttl的数据么_esp8266可以接ttl的数据么_11


最后点击开发完成并发布按钮,完成最终的产品信息配置。

esp8266可以接ttl的数据么_仿真器_12


四、代码修改、程序下载、配置

4.1、计算Name、Password

按提示下载计算工具

esp8266可以接ttl的数据么_esp8266可以接ttl的数据么_13


esp8266可以接ttl的数据么_云计算_14


下载完成之后请自行解压,并双击打开sign.html文件

esp8266可以接ttl的数据么_esp8266可以接ttl的数据么_15


按照提示寻找ProductID、DeviceName、DeviceSceret并进行计算

esp8266可以接ttl的数据么_esp8266可以接ttl的数据么_16


esp8266可以接ttl的数据么_仿真器_17


4.2、修改代码

按照提示获取域名以及端口号

esp8266可以接ttl的数据么_仿真器_18


将域名以及端口号保存下来

esp8266可以接ttl的数据么_云计算_19


按照提示修改端口、域名以及WiFi名称密码

esp8266可以接ttl的数据么_腾讯云_20


按照提示修改ProductKey,ClientID、Username

esp8266可以接ttl的数据么_仿真器_21


按照提示获取Topic、TopicPost

esp8266可以接ttl的数据么_云计算_22


按照提示修改Topic、TopicPost

注意${deviceName}替换成自己的设备名称

esp8266可以接ttl的数据么_stm32_23


4.3、配置ST-Link仿真器

点击配置仿真器

esp8266可以接ttl的数据么_stm32_24


esp8266可以接ttl的数据么_腾讯云_25


esp8266可以接ttl的数据么_仿真器_26


esp8266可以接ttl的数据么_腾讯云_27


esp8266可以接ttl的数据么_腾讯云_28


esp8266可以接ttl的数据么_云计算_29


4.4、代码下载

esp8266可以接ttl的数据么_esp8266可以接ttl的数据么_30


esp8266可以接ttl的数据么_腾讯云_31


五、查看数据

5.1、查看上传的温湿度数据

从图中可以看到我们的温湿度数据已经实时上传到腾讯云的物联网平台了

esp8266可以接ttl的数据么_腾讯云_32